Fan-out backpressure on Quillcast notifications: symptoms are delayed pushes and a climbing relay queue. Do not retry sends manually; that multiplies the backlog. Check the queue depth dashboard first. Under 100k, wait it out. Over 100k, page platform on-call and pause digest campaigns from the admin panel. Tell customers delivery is delayed, not lost. Escalation steps and the pause procedure are documented on the internal page below.

runbook for tajep-yahig: https://artifactory.lumictech.corp/repo

Runbook — migrating cron jobs to Loomflow

Plugin authors migrating scheduled jobs from host cron to the Loomflow workflow engine must declare idempotency explicitly; Loomflow may re-dispatch a task after a coordinator failover. Wrap any side-effecting step in the provided dedup guard and set a retry ceiling. Validate your manifest against the engine version recorded below.

session token of hawif-bajog = htk6_9ab8da

## Onboarding: The Autocomplete Index in Searchwick

Reviewers should know that Searchwick's autocomplete index rebuilds nightly and is our slowest pipeline stage, currently around forty minutes. Any PR touching the tokenizer or prefix-trie layout triggers a full rebuild in CI, so budget for that. Check the `index_build_p95` panel before approving changes that alter shard counts; we've regressed this twice. Rebuild jobs run on the Fernholt cluster and must be submitted with a signed job manifest. The signing key for manifests appears below.

signing key of bagap-yawep = bky13_TbfT6ZMUoGJo2

Q: How do I get into the basement archive room at Thornfield Annex? A: Contractors do not receive permanent archive access. Sign in at reception, collect a day pass, and take the service stairs — the lift does not stop at B1. No materials leave the room. Doors auto-lock behind you. For the duration of your engagement, enter using the code below.

door code, yagap-bahof: bdg-O-05